反射.class、class.forname() 和 getClass() 的區別

反射 概念 Java的反射機制在運行的狀態,對於任何一個實體類,都可以知道這個類的全部屬性和方法;對於任意一個對象,都可以調用它的任意方法和屬性;這種動態獲取信息以及動態調用對象方法的功能被稱爲java語言的反射機制。 能夠理解爲在運行時期得到對象類型信息的操做。傳統的編程方法要求程序員在編譯階段決定使用哪些類型,可是在反射的幫助下,編程人員能夠動態獲取這些信息,從而編寫更加具備可移植性的代碼。j
相關文章
相關標籤/搜索